Largo to Cheyenne

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Largo to Cheyenne is a long-distance trip. Flying from Tampa International Airport to Cheyenne Regional Airport is the most practical choice, usually requiring one or two connections. Driving is a major expedition of over 3,200 kilometers, taking roughly 30 hours of driving time via I-75 and I-80. This route takes you from the humid Florida coast to the high plains of Wyoming.

Total Distance: Driving distance 3,200 km, straight-line air distance 2,600 km.
